This Global Conversation brings together perspectives from pioneering art foundations worldwide, exploring how contemporary patronage is shaping the future of culture. Private foundations and institutions do more than preserve works of art or engage in philanthropy; they establish the very conditions for art to exist, experiment, produce, and be passed down through generations. At a time when public institutions face growing economic and structural constraints, contemporary patronage is playing a vital role—building vibrant cultural ecosystems, championing artists and curators, commissioning new work, fostering research, and opening dynamic new pathways for public participation. About Patrizia Sandretto Re Rebaudengo

Patrizia Sandretto Re Rebaudengo is one of the world’s most prominent contemporary art collectors, philanthropists, and patrons. Since starting her collection in 1992, she has championed artists, commissioned new works, and built an internationally renowned platform for contemporary culture. In 1995, she established the Fondazione Sandretto Re Rebaudengo in Turin, a leading non-profit institution dedicated to supporting living artists, curatorial research, and public engagement. Expanding her philanthropic footprint across Europe, she founded Fundación Sandretto Re Rebaudengo Madrid in 2017 to foster cultural exchanges between Europe and Latin America, followed by Fondazione Sandretto Re Rebaudengo Venice on the historic Isola San Giacomo in the Venetian Lagoon, dedicated to artistic research, site-specific installations, and ecological sustainability.

As an active writer and advocate for patronage, she has authored publications on contemporary collecting and art ecosystems. She serves on major international advisory boards—including MoMA (New York), Tate (London), the Leadership Council of the New Museum in New York, the Advisory Committee for Modern and Contemporary Art of the Philadelphia Museum of Art, the Conseil d’Administration of the École Nationale Supérieure des Beaux-Arts in Lyon, the CCS Board of Governors at Bard College in New York, and the Board of Trustees of ICI in New York. She has received numerous prestigious awards for her enduring contributions to global arts and philanthropy. She is also a patron of the Fundación Museo Reina Sofía and the Fundación MACBA in Barcelona, as well as a major patron of CIMAM – the International Committee for Museums and Collections of Modern Art.

Over the years, she has received numerous awards and honorary titles, including the title of Commendatore of the Italian Republic (2023) and the Chevalier de l’Ordre des Arts et des Lettres, bestowed by the French Republic (2009).
